CELTIC left it to the last game of the Europa campaign to grab a win but it was about time and the bhoys put up a real fighting spirit to make sure they grabbed the victory at Celtic Park.

We lead three times in the game but were pegged back twice. The first goal was a mistake by McGregor and the second Lille goal was a fantastic strike by Timo Weah who caught it on the volley.

With the game finely posied at 2-2 and Lille pushing for the win, Celtic and their young players dug deep and came up with a bit of magic. First from Kristoffer Ajer who showed fantastic footwork to get down the wing and then Turnbull who anticipated the cut back and placed it into the back of the net for the winner.
